Responsibilities

Job Purpose

The Senior Infrastructure Architect is responsible for designing, evaluating, and implementing IT infrastructure solutions that support the organization’s business operations and long-term strategy. They work across teams to ensure infrastructure components—including hardware, cloud services, and network systems—are integrated, scalable, secure, and aligned with enterprise architecture standards.

Key Responsibilities

  • Collaborate with enterprise and solution architects to align infrastructure designs with business requirements and architectural standards.
  • Design infrastructure solutions covering cloud, on-premise, and hybrid environments that ensure performance, availability, and security.
  • Evaluate and recommend infrastructure technologies to meet evolving business needs.
  • Support the deployment and integration of infrastructure components, working with cross-functional teams and external vendors.
  • Contribute to ensuring infrastructure solutions meet disaster recovery and business continuity requirements.
  • Maintain up-to-date knowledge of emerging infrastructure technologies and contribute to proof-of-concept and pilot implementations.
  • Provide architectural guidance during infrastructure implementation and troubleshooting phases.
